нужно создать запрос, в котором выводятся два первых документа и два последних
Не могу понять, в чем проблема: нужно создать запрос, в котором выводятся два первых документа и два последних. Все выводится, но задваивается: ВЫБРАТЬ РАЗЛИЧНЫЕ ПЕРВЫЕ 2 ПКО.
Котик Котикович (user1949990) 19.05.2023 15:36:20
Обращение. Мое имя Котик Котикович, комментарий Здравствуйте! Не могу понять, в чем проблема: нужно создать запрос, в котором выводятся два первых документа и два последних. Все выводится, но задваивается:
ВЫБРАТЬ РАЗЛИЧНЫЕ ПЕРВЫЕ 2
ПКО.Ссылка КАК Ссылка
ПОМЕСТИТЬ первая
ИЗ
Документ.ПКО КАК ПКО
УПОРЯДОЧИТЬ ПО
Ссылка
;
////////////////////////////////////////////////////////////////////////////////
ВЫБРАТЬ РАЗЛИЧНЫЕ ПЕРВЫЕ 2
ПКО.Ссылка КАК Ссылка
ПОМЕСТИТЬ вторая
ИЗ
Документ.ПКО КАК ПКО
УПОРЯДОЧИТЬ ПО
Ссылка УБЫВ
;
////////////////////////////////////////////////////////////////////////////////
ВЫБРАТЬ
первая.Ссылка,
вторая.Ссылка КАК Ссылка1
ИЗ
первая КАК первая,
вторая КАК вторая.
Котик Котикович (user1949990) 19.05.2023 15:36:20
Обращение. Мое имя Котик Котикович, комментарий Здравствуйте! Не могу понять, в чем проблема: нужно создать запрос, в котором выводятся два первых документа и два последних. Все выводится, но задваивается:
ВЫБРАТЬ РАЗЛИЧНЫЕ ПЕРВЫЕ 2
ПКО.Ссылка КАК Ссылка
ПОМЕСТИТЬ первая
ИЗ
Документ.ПКО КАК ПКО
УПОРЯДОЧИТЬ ПО
Ссылка
;
////////////////////////////////////////////////////////////
ВЫБРАТЬ РАЗЛИЧНЫЕ ПЕРВЫЕ 2
ПКО.Ссылка КАК Ссылка
ПОМЕСТИТЬ вторая
ИЗ
Документ.ПКО КАК ПКО
УПОРЯДОЧИТЬ ПО
Ссылка УБЫВ
;
////////////////////////////////////////////////////////////
ВЫБРАТЬ
первая.Ссылка,
вторая.Ссылка КАК Ссылка1
ИЗ
первая КАК первая,
вторая КАК вторая.
Прикрепленные файлы:

По теме из базы знаний
- Запросы. Временные Таблицы. Сравнение методов создания ВТ
- Свертка базы - или как свернуть базу УТ 10.3
- Планы запросов - это просто! Разбор оптимизаций запросов PostgreSQL на живых примерах
- Когда интерфейсам 1С нужны веб-технологии
- Быстрый фронт в базе размером 6.8 терабайт – наши стандарты при разработке и рефакторинге запросов
Найденные решения
А, торможу упорядочивание только после объединить работатет.
так
ВЫБРАТЬ РАЗЛИЧНЫЕ ПЕРВЫЕ 2
ПКО.Ссылка
ПОМЕСТИТЬ Таб1
ИЗ
Документ.ПКО КАК ПКО
УПОРЯДОЧИТЬ ПО
ПКО.Ссылка
;
ВЫБРАТЬ РАЗЛИЧНЫЕ ПЕРВЫЕ 2
ПКО.Ссылка
ПОМЕСТИТЬ Таб2
ИЗ
Документ.ПКО КАК ПКО
УПОРЯДОЧИТЬ ПО
ПКО.Ссылка УБЫВ
;
ВЫБРАТЬ
Таб1.Ссылка
Из Таб1
ОБЪЕДИНИТЬ ВСЕ
ВЫБРАТЬ
Таб2.Ссылка
Из Таб2
а потом выгружаешь запрос в ТЗ
и по индексам получаешь нужные данные
так
ВЫБРАТЬ РАЗЛИЧНЫЕ ПЕРВЫЕ 2
ПКО.Ссылка
ПОМЕСТИТЬ Таб1
ИЗ
Документ.ПКО КАК ПКО
УПОРЯДОЧИТЬ ПО
ПКО.Ссылка
;
ВЫБРАТЬ РАЗЛИЧНЫЕ ПЕРВЫЕ 2
ПКО.Ссылка
ПОМЕСТИТЬ Таб2
ИЗ
Документ.ПКО КАК ПКО
УПОРЯДОЧИТЬ ПО
ПКО.Ссылка УБЫВ
;
ВЫБРАТЬ
Таб1.Ссылка
Из Таб1
ОБЪЕДИНИТЬ ВСЕ
ВЫБРАТЬ
Таб2.Ссылка
Из Таб2
а потом выгружаешь запрос в ТЗ
и по индексам получаешь нужные данные
(7)
ВЫБРАТЬ РАЗЛИЧНЫЕ ПЕРВЫЕ 2
ПКО.Ссылка
ПОМЕСТИТЬ Таб1
ИЗ
Документ.ПКО КАК ПКО
УПОРЯДОЧИТЬ ПО
ПКО.Ссылка
;
ВЫБРАТЬ РАЗЛИЧНЫЕ ПЕРВЫЕ 2
ПКО.Ссылка
ПОМЕСТИТЬ Таб2
ИЗ
Документ.ПКО КАК ПКО
УПОРЯДОЧИТЬ ПО
ПКО.Ссылка УБЫВ
;
ВЫБРАТЬ
Таб1.Ссылка
Из Таб1
ОБЪЕДИНИТЬ ВСЕ
ВЫБРАТЬ
Таб2.Ссылка
Из Таб2
ПоказатьПКО.Ссылка
ПОМЕСТИТЬ Таб1
ИЗ
Документ.ПКО КАК ПКО
УПОРЯДОЧИТЬ ПО
ПКО.Ссылка
;
ВЫБРАТЬ РАЗЛИЧНЫЕ ПЕРВЫЕ 2
ПКО.Ссылка
ПОМЕСТИТЬ Таб2
ИЗ
Документ.ПКО КАК ПКО
УПОРЯДОЧИТЬ ПО
ПКО.Ссылка УБЫВ
;
ВЫБРАТЬ
Таб1.Ссылка
Из Таб1
ОБЪЕДИНИТЬ ВСЕ
ВЫБРАТЬ
Таб2.Ссылка
Из Таб2
Остальные ответы
Подписаться на ответы
Инфостарт бот
Сортировка:
Древо развёрнутое
Свернуть все
ВЫБРАТЬ РАЗЛИЧНЫЕ ПЕРВЫЕ 2
ПКО.Ссылка КАК Старые,
Неопределено КАК Новые
ИЗ
Документ.ПКО КАК ПКО
УПОРЯДОЧИТЬ ПО
Ссылка
ОБЪЕДИНИТЬ ВСЕ
ВЫБРАТЬ РАЗЛИЧНЫЕ ПЕРВЫЕ 2
Неопределено,
ПКО.Ссылка
ИЗ
Документ.ПКО КАК ПКО
УПОРЯДОЧИТЬ ПО
Ссылка УБЫВ
ПКО.Ссылка КАК Старые,
Неопределено КАК Новые
ИЗ
Документ.ПКО КАК ПКО
УПОРЯДОЧИТЬ ПО
Ссылка
ОБЪЕДИНИТЬ ВСЕ
ВЫБРАТЬ РАЗЛИЧНЫЕ ПЕРВЫЕ 2
Неопределено,
ПКО.Ссылка
ИЗ
Документ.ПКО КАК ПКО
УПОРЯДОЧИТЬ ПО
Ссылка УБЫВ
А, торможу упорядочивание только после объединить работатет.
так
ВЫБРАТЬ РАЗЛИЧНЫЕ ПЕРВЫЕ 2
ПКО.Ссылка
ПОМЕСТИТЬ Таб1
ИЗ
Документ.ПКО КАК ПКО
УПОРЯДОЧИТЬ ПО
ПКО.Ссылка
;
ВЫБРАТЬ РАЗЛИЧНЫЕ ПЕРВЫЕ 2
ПКО.Ссылка
ПОМЕСТИТЬ Таб2
ИЗ
Документ.ПКО КАК ПКО
УПОРЯДОЧИТЬ ПО
ПКО.Ссылка УБЫВ
;
ВЫБРАТЬ
Таб1.Ссылка
Из Таб1
ОБЪЕДИНИТЬ ВСЕ
ВЫБРАТЬ
Таб2.Ссылка
Из Таб2
а потом выгружаешь запрос в ТЗ
и по индексам получаешь нужные данные
так
ВЫБРАТЬ РАЗЛИЧНЫЕ ПЕРВЫЕ 2
ПКО.Ссылка
ПОМЕСТИТЬ Таб1
ИЗ
Документ.ПКО КАК ПКО
УПОРЯДОЧИТЬ ПО
ПКО.Ссылка
;
ВЫБРАТЬ РАЗЛИЧНЫЕ ПЕРВЫЕ 2
ПКО.Ссылка
ПОМЕСТИТЬ Таб2
ИЗ
Документ.ПКО КАК ПКО
УПОРЯДОЧИТЬ ПО
ПКО.Ссылка УБЫВ
;
ВЫБРАТЬ
Таб1.Ссылка
Из Таб1
ОБЪЕДИНИТЬ ВСЕ
ВЫБРАТЬ
Таб2.Ссылка
Из Таб2
а потом выгружаешь запрос в ТЗ
и по индексам получаешь нужные данные
(7)
ВЫБРАТЬ РАЗЛИЧНЫЕ ПЕРВЫЕ 2
ПКО.Ссылка
ПОМЕСТИТЬ Таб1
ИЗ
Документ.ПКО КАК ПКО
УПОРЯДОЧИТЬ ПО
ПКО.Ссылка
;
ВЫБРАТЬ РАЗЛИЧНЫЕ ПЕРВЫЕ 2
ПКО.Ссылка
ПОМЕСТИТЬ Таб2
ИЗ
Документ.ПКО КАК ПКО
УПОРЯДОЧИТЬ ПО
ПКО.Ссылка УБЫВ
;
ВЫБРАТЬ
Таб1.Ссылка
Из Таб1
ОБЪЕДИНИТЬ ВСЕ
ВЫБРАТЬ
Таб2.Ссылка
Из Таб2
ПоказатьПКО.Ссылка
ПОМЕСТИТЬ Таб1
ИЗ
Документ.ПКО КАК ПКО
УПОРЯДОЧИТЬ ПО
ПКО.Ссылка
;
ВЫБРАТЬ РАЗЛИЧНЫЕ ПЕРВЫЕ 2
ПКО.Ссылка
ПОМЕСТИТЬ Таб2
ИЗ
Документ.ПКО КАК ПКО
УПОРЯДОЧИТЬ ПО
ПКО.Ссылка УБЫВ
;
ВЫБРАТЬ
Таб1.Ссылка
Из Таб1
ОБЪЕДИНИТЬ ВСЕ
ВЫБРАТЬ
Таб2.Ссылка
Из Таб2
(9)
а вот это спорно
А чего тут спорного? Спорить тут не о чем. Представьте у вас всего один документ. Он попал как меньший так и больший. А далее вы его включили дважды так как "ОБЪЕДИНИТЬ ВСЕ" вместо "ОБЪЕДИНИТЬ". Если всего два документа, то в вашем варианте будет два документа два раза. Если три, то первый и последний по разу, а средний дважды.
Для получения уведомлений об ответах подключите телеграм бот:
Инфостарт бот